Body temperature sensor for detecting human health of patient
Technical Field
The utility model relates to a measuring device technical field for the medical treatment specifically is a body temperature sensor is used in human health detection of patient.
Background
The body temperature measurement is a commonly used examination method for diagnosing diseases, and comprises three methods of oral cavity temperature measurement, armpit temperature measurement and anus temperature measurement, wherein the armpit temperature measurement is performed under most conditions, the oral temperature measurement and the anus temperature measurement are rarely used, the middle part cannot be interrupted when the armpit temperature measurement is performed every time, and the thermometer must be always tightened to be the most accurate and is not suitable: mental disorder, coma, infant and baby, oral diseases, mouth and nose cavity operation, dyspnea, and incapability of cooperating persons to measure the temperature by mouth surface.
The clinical thermometer that uses at present is the mercury clinical thermometer mostly, a small amount of digital clinical thermometer that uses, and the mercury clinical thermometer is easy damaged and then causes the injury to the human body when using, and the digital clinical thermometer can't carry out real time monitoring to the body temperature of human body, to some patients that need be in hospital the change of body temperature can't monitor in real time, probably cause the deterioration of the state of an illness, and the digital clinical thermometer can't measure patient's body temperature moreover for medical personnel's later stage can't carry out effectual analysis to patient's the state of an illness.

Referring to fig. 1-3, a body temperature sensor for detecting the human health of a patient comprises a shell 1, a display 4 is fixedly installed on the front side of the shell 1, a control button 3 is fixedly installed on the front side of the shell 1, the peak body temperature of the patient can be set through the control button 3, different peak body temperatures can be set for different patients, a buzzer 2 is fixedly installed on the front side of the shell 1, the buzzer 2 can give an alarm when the body temperature of the patient is abnormal, medical personnel can quickly process the patient, the patient is prevented from being injured by delaying the state of illness, a waveform signal line 12 is fixedly connected to the right side surface of the shell 1, a socket matched with the waveform signal line 12 is formed in the side surface of the shell 1, a flexible polyester outer sleeve is wrapped on the outer surface of the waveform signal line 12, and can prevent discomfort brought to the patient when the waveform signal line 12 is contacted with the skin of the patient, the other end of the waveform signal wire 12 is fixedly connected with a detection plate 11, the inside of the detection plate 11 is fixedly provided with a temperature sensor 10, the model of the temperature sensor 10 is PT100, the side surface of the detection plate 11 is fixedly connected with a protective belt 13, the other end of the protective belt 13 is fixedly connected with an elastic belt 14, the number of the elastic belts 14 is two, two ends of the two elastic belts 14 are respectively connected with a plug 9 and a socket 15, the temperature sensor 10 can be tightly attached to the armpit of a patient through the matching of the protective belt 13 and the elastic belt 14, so that the numerical value measured by the temperature sensor 10 cannot generate overlarge errors, the left side surface of the shell 1 is fixedly provided with a fixed plate 8, the left side surface at the top of the fixed plate 8 is fixedly provided with a movable seat 6, the side surface of the movable seat 6 is fixedly provided with a clamping plate 7, the left side surface of, the temperature change on the display 4 can be conveniently observed by patients and medical staff, the other end of the spring 5 is fixedly connected with the right side surface of the clamping plate 7 positioned above the movable seat 6, the front surface of the inner cavity of the shell 1 is fixedly provided with a single chip microcomputer 16, the model of the single chip microcomputer 16 is CC2530, the temperature sensor 10 is electrically connected with the single chip microcomputer 16, the single chip microcomputer 16 is electrically connected with the display 4, the top of the single chip microcomputer 16 is fixedly welded with a signal emitter 19, the front surface of the single chip microcomputer 16 is fixedly welded with a data storage 18, the single chip microcomputer 16 is electrically connected with the signal emitter 19 and the data storage 18, the data of the temperature sensor 10 is processed by the single chip microcomputer 16 and can be transmitted to the display 4 for displaying, the body temperature data of the patients can be stored in real time by the data storage 18, and the body temperature data can, make better treatment scheme for the patient, signal transmitter 19 gives signal receiver with signal transmission, signal receiver can give the PC end of hospital with signal transmission, so that the doctor can observe the body temperature of a lot of patients simultaneously, and the PC end still can regularly sends patient's body temperature information to the removal receiving terminal of patient's family members regularly, make patient's family members also can master patient's body temperature change, the front fixed mounting of shell 1 inner chamber has mainboard 17, mainboard 17 can give singlechip 16 with the value transmission that control button 3 adjusted, a carrier is provided for control button 3 simultaneously, control button 3's quantity is three, fixed welding has the button seat with three control button 3 one-to-one on the mainboard 17.
The working principle is that when the device is used, the fixing plate 8 needs to be tightly attached to the side face of a sickbed, the top of the clamping plate 7 is pressed, then the top of the clamping plate 7 is loosened, the force of the spring 5 acts on the clamping plate 7 at the moment, the device is fixed beside the sickbed under the combined action of the clamping plate 7 and the fixing plate 8, the detection plate 11 is tightly attached to the armpit of a person, the plug 9 and the socket 15 are clamped, the peak body temperature is adjusted through the control button 3, the temperature sensor 10 transmits a signal to the singlechip 16 through the waveform signal wire 12, the singlechip 16 displays the data through the display 4, the data obtained by the singlechip 16 is stored by the data storage 18, when the temperature value transmitted to the singlechip 16 by the temperature sensor 10 is larger than the set peak body temperature, the singlechip 16 controls the buzzer 2 to emit the sound of dripping, and meanwhile, the singlechip 16 transmits the signal to the signal receiver at the far, the signal receiver transmits the signal to the PC end, and the PC end processes, analyzes and stores the signal and then sends the information to the mobile receiving end of the family of the patient.
